Address

MDS4ud7DrFZHftfVEe8vC6hEQYL2UCAoLP

0 MONA

Confirmed
Total Received19.38032644 MONA39.34 CNY
Total Sent19.38032644 MONA39.34 CNY
Final Balance0 MONA0.00 CNY
No. Transactions2

Transactions

MDS4ud7DrFZHftfVEe8vC6hEQYL2UCAoLP19.38032644 MONA573.31 CNY39.34 CNY
 
MH6mgMGYcNx4SZqQww4HhqMpyJ2d1mm6SC2.04007087 MONA60.35 CNY4.14 CNY
MJY5W5Qw3ZsxNvarNVf9yV1Ge7GefF6EpZ17.34002349 MONA512.96 CNY35.20 CNY
METTzSJXucHGShmivJk7LWh43sMw6D53nJ19.47727302 MONA576.18 CNY39.54 CNY
 
MDS4ud7DrFZHftfVEe8vC6hEQYL2UCAoLP19.38032644 MONA573.31 CNY39.34 CNY
MKw5JiRmwcYovpfa9HjUV5AasoxEEzTt2x0.09671448 MONA2.86 CNY0.20 CNY